MGR University BSc course is a three years undergraduate course that is offered in full-time mode. BSc at MGR University is available in several specialisations, such as BSc in Nursing, Nuclear Medicine Technology, Cardiac Technology, etc.
Selection of candidates for the MGR University BSc admissions is done on merit basis. Candidates will be evaluated based on their scores in Class 12 board exams. In order to be eligible for BSc admissions, candidates need to fulfill the eligibility criteria tabulated below:
| Course Name | Eligibility Criteria |
|---|---|
| BSc | Cleared Class 12 board exams with a minimum aggregate of 40% in any stream from a recognised board. |

Deserving and meritorious students are offered scholarships by MGR Medical University based on their academic performance and other criteria. Here are some of scholarships available at MGR Medical University:
- Tamil Nadu Government Scholarship: SC/ ST/ OBC students are eligible to get scholarship, they have scored 75 percent in their Class 12 and obtain a certain percentage in entrance examination.
- MGR Medical University Need-cum-Merit Scholarship: Students from minority communities are eligible to get scholarship if they secure 75 percent in Class 12.
- Students from economically disadvantaged backgrounds are also eligible to apply for scholarship offered by University.
The Tamil Nadu Dr. MGR Medical University is situated in the Southern part of the City of Chennai (formerly Madras) in the State of Tamil Nadu, South India. It is about 6 Km from the Chennai International & National Airport and about 12 Km from the Chennai Central Railway Station. MGR Medical University is one of the premier medical universities named after the former Chief Minister of Tamil Nadu, (late) Hon. Dr. MG Ramachandran (MGR) and it is the second the largest Health Sciences University in India.

At MGR Medical University, students can pursue the BSc programme across multiple specialisations. The eligibility criteria for the course is same across all of the specialisations. Students must pass Class 12 or equivalent with a minimym aggregate of 40% from a recognised board to be eligible for the programme. The university provides the BSc course acorss the following specialisations through its various affiliated colleges:
- BSc in Cardiac Technology
- BSc in Nursing
- BSc in Operation Theatre and Anesthesia Technology
- BSc in Radiography and Imaging Technology
- BSc in Medical Laborartry Technology
- BSc in Neuro-Electrophysiology

Here is the list of documents required during filling out the application form for MGR Medical University courses application form.
- Class 10 mark sheet
- Class 12 mark sheet
- UG degree (if applicable)
- PG degree (if applicable)
- Transfer Certificate
- Nativity Certificate (if required)
- Community Certificate (if required)
- Certificate for proof of study from Class 6 to Class 12 (candidate who studied in Tamil Nadu)
The MGR University promotes research, disseminates knowledge, and is eligible for central assistance under UGC Act 1956 (UGC letter No. F.9-14/2007 [CPP-I] dt 12.3.2008). MGR University is the only Medical University in Tamil Nadu that is capable of granting affiliation to new institutions under Government or Self-financing in Medical, Dental, Indian Medicine/Homoeopathy & Allied Health Sciences (Pharmacy, Nursing, Physiotherapy, Occupational therapy and many others) and awarding degrees under a single umbrella to maintain uniform and high standards of education. Until 1988, all degrees in Health Sciences were awarded by the University of Madras.
